If you crank the dampener **** all the way to the right (full stiff) then you will feel more difference
. I ran my car on the stock 16's with my Flex for a while and the ride was pretty nice. The ride gets quite a bit firmer once you increase rim size to 18's. After I installed the TRD sway bars my car got really stiff. The upside to all this is that my handling is pretty damn good now. Switching lanes is just a quick flick of the wrist and high speed turns are no problem
I'm sure you will enjoy your Flex just as much as I've enjoyed mine. The only complaint I have is that they are quite noisy with the windows rolled up, but I drive with the windows down most of the time so that's not really an issue for me
